Record Store Day in Australia features a variety of special releases that excite collectors and music enthusiasts alike. These include exclusive vinyl pressings, limited edition box sets, artist collaborations, rare reissues, and highlights from regional artists.

Exclusive vinyl pressings

Exclusive vinyl pressings are unique records made specifically for Record Store Day, often featuring special artwork or colored vinyl. These pressings are typically available only at participating independent record stores, making them highly sought after by collectors.

To secure these exclusive releases, visit your local record store early on Record Store Day, as quantities are usually limited. Some popular titles may sell out within hours, so it’s wise to check store listings in advance.

Limited edition box sets

Limited edition box sets often include multiple albums, special packaging, and additional content like booklets or memorabilia. These sets are designed for serious collectors and can feature both classic albums and new releases.

When considering a box set, look for details on the number of copies produced and the included extras. Prices can vary significantly, so compare options at different stores to find the best deal.

Artist collaborations

Artist collaborations for Record Store Day often result in unique releases that showcase the talents of multiple musicians. These collaborations can include new tracks, remixes, or live recordings that are exclusive to the event.

Keep an eye on announcements from your favorite artists leading up to Record Store Day, as these releases can generate significant buzz and may be limited in quantity.

Rare reissues

Rare reissues are remastered versions of classic albums that are released exclusively for Record Store Day. These reissues may feature improved sound quality, new artwork, or bonus tracks that were not included in the original release.

Collectors should pay attention to the pressing details, as some reissues may be pressed on colored vinyl or include special packaging, making them more desirable.

Regional artist highlights

Regional artist highlights showcase local talent and often feature exclusive tracks or live recordings. These releases help promote Australian artists and provide a platform for them to reach a wider audience.

Support your local music scene by checking out these regional releases during Record Store Day. They can be a great way to discover new music and support homegrown talent.

Promotional events significantly enhance Record Store Day by creating a vibrant atmosphere that attracts collectors and music enthusiasts. These events foster community engagement and excitement around exclusive vinyl releases, making the day more memorable for attendees.

Live performances by local artists

Live performances by local artists are a staple of Record Store Day, drawing crowds and adding energy to the event. These performances often feature a mix of genres, showcasing both established and emerging talent from the area.

Attendees can enjoy intimate concerts, which not only promote local musicians but also create a unique shopping experience. Many record stores schedule these performances throughout the day, allowing fans to discover new music while browsing exclusive vinyl releases.

In-store signings and meet-and-greets

In-store signings and meet-and-greets with artists provide fans a chance to connect directly with their favorite musicians. These events often feature special guests who may have released exclusive vinyl for Record Store Day.

Collectors value these opportunities, as they can get items signed, take photos, and engage in conversations with artists. Stores may limit the number of attendees or require purchases to ensure a smooth experience, so it’s wise to check ahead for any specific requirements.

Exclusive giveaways and contests

Exclusive giveaways and contests are popular promotional strategies during Record Store Day, enticing customers to participate and visit local stores. Many shops offer limited-edition merchandise, such as posters or special vinyl editions, as prizes.

Contests may involve social media engagement, such as sharing photos from the event or tagging the store, which helps increase visibility and excitement. Customers should stay informed about these opportunities, as they can enhance the overall experience and provide additional incentives to visit local record stores.

Collector excitement for Record Store Day vinyl is primarily fueled by the unique offerings and community atmosphere surrounding the event. Limited releases, special promotions, and the chance to connect with fellow enthusiasts create a vibrant environment that attracts both seasoned collectors and new fans alike.

Scarcity of limited releases

The scarcity of limited releases is a significant factor in driving collector excitement. Many records are produced in small quantities, making them highly sought after. For example, a popular album might be released in a run of only 1,000 copies, which can lead to a frenzy among collectors eager to secure their piece.

This limited availability often results in higher resale values, with some records appreciating significantly over time. Collectors should be aware that the most coveted items can sell out quickly, so arriving early at participating stores is crucial.

Community engagement and culture

Record Store Day fosters a sense of community among music lovers, enhancing the overall experience. Many stores host events, live performances, and meet-and-greets with artists, creating a festive atmosphere that encourages social interaction. This communal aspect is a key draw for collectors, as it allows them to share their passion with others.

Engaging with fellow collectors can also provide valuable insights into trends and hidden gems in the vinyl market. Participating in discussions and events can deepen one’s appreciation for music and the collecting hobby.

Investment potential of rare records

The investment potential of rare records is another factor that excites collectors. While not every vinyl will appreciate in value, certain limited editions and artist-signed copies can yield significant returns. For instance, records from iconic artists or landmark albums often see their prices soar in the resale market.

Collectors should research market trends and consider factors such as condition, rarity, and demand when evaluating records as investments. Keeping an eye on auction sites and collector forums can help identify valuable opportunities, but it’s essential to approach collecting with a balance of passion and practicality.

To prepare for Record Store Day in Australia, start by familiarizing yourself with exclusive vinyl releases and planning your store visits. Engaging with collector communities can also enhance your experience and help you secure sought-after items.

Research exclusive releases

Exclusive releases for Record Store Day often include limited edition vinyl, special color variants, and unique pressings. Check the official Record Store Day website or local record store announcements to find a list of these special items. Knowing what’s available will help you prioritize your shopping list.

Many releases are highly sought after, so consider setting alerts for announcements and following relevant social media pages. This way, you can stay updated on any last-minute changes or additional releases that may be announced.

Plan store visits in advance

Planning your store visits is crucial for a successful Record Store Day experience. Identify which local record stores are participating and their opening hours. Some stores may even have special events or promotions, so check their websites or call ahead for details.

Consider visiting multiple stores if possible, as different locations may carry different exclusive releases. Arriving early can also increase your chances of snagging the most popular items before they sell out.

Join collector communities

Joining collector communities can provide valuable insights and tips for navigating Record Store Day. Online forums, social media groups, and local meetups are great places to connect with other vinyl enthusiasts who share your passion.

These communities often share information about exclusive releases, store events, and even trading opportunities. Engaging with fellow collectors can enhance your experience and help you discover hidden gems you might have missed otherwise.

To successfully purchase vinyl on Record Store Day, plan ahead and prioritize your strategy. Arriving early, knowing the exclusive releases, and being prepared for potential crowds can significantly enhance your chances of securing desired records.

Arrive early at stores

Arriving early is crucial on Record Store Day, as many exclusive vinyl releases are limited in quantity and highly sought after. Stores often open their doors early, and being among the first in line can give you access to the best selections.

Consider arriving at least one to two hours before the store opens, especially if it is a popular location. Bring a friend to help hold your place in line or to share the experience, as this can make the wait more enjoyable.

Check with local stores ahead of time for their opening hours and any special events planned for the day. Some stores may even offer incentives for early arrivals, such as exclusive giveaways or discounts on future purchases.
